首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

过滤后是否更新角度分页器?

过滤后是否更新角度分页器是一个与前端开发和数据处理相关的问题。

在前端开发中,角度分页器(Angular Paginator)是一个用于处理数据分页的组件。它可以根据用户的需求,将大量数据分成多个页面进行展示,提高用户体验和页面加载速度。

当用户在页面上进行数据过滤操作时,例如使用搜索功能或选择特定的筛选条件,如果过滤后的数据集合发生变化,通常需要更新角度分页器以反映新的数据状态。

更新角度分页器的步骤通常包括以下几个方面:

  1. 监听过滤条件的变化:通过在前端代码中添加事件监听器或使用数据绑定机制,监测过滤条件的变化。
  2. 过滤数据集合:根据新的过滤条件,对原始数据集合进行筛选,得到过滤后的数据集合。
  3. 更新分页器参数:根据过滤后的数据集合,更新分页器的参数,例如总页数、当前页码等。
  4. 更新页面内容:根据更新后的分页器参数,重新渲染页面内容,显示过滤后的数据。

过滤后是否更新角度分页器的实际操作步骤可能因具体的前端框架和组件库而有所不同。在Angular框架中,可以使用内置的数据绑定和变更检测机制来实现这一功能。

对于过滤后是否更新角度分页器的应用场景,它适用于需要展示大量数据并支持用户进行数据过滤的场景,例如电子商务网站的商品列表页面、新闻网站的文章列表页面等。

腾讯云提供了一系列与前端开发和数据处理相关的产品和服务,以下是一些推荐的产品和产品介绍链接:

  1. 云函数(Serverless Cloud Function):腾讯云云函数是一种无服务器计算服务,可以帮助开发者在云端运行代码,实现数据处理和业务逻辑。详情请参考:云函数产品介绍
  2. 云数据库MySQL版(TencentDB for MySQL):腾讯云云数据库MySQL版是一种高性能、可扩展的关系型数据库服务,适用于存储和管理大量结构化数据。详情请参考:云数据库MySQL版产品介绍
  3. 云存储(对象存储COS):腾讯云云存储是一种安全、稳定、高扩展性的云端存储服务,适用于存储和管理各类文件和多媒体资源。详情请参考:云存储产品介绍

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求和项目要求进行评估。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• git服务实现自动部署代码,本地push服务端自动更新

    不知道大家平时都是怎么样更新自己生产环境的代码的,FTP 覆盖旧文件、服务定时任务去 build 最新的源码,还是有更高级的做法? 目前我在使用 Git Hook 来部署自己的项目。...Git Hook 是 Git 提供的一个钩子,能被特定的事件触发调用。...其实,更通俗的讲,当你设置了 Git Hook ,只要你的远程仓库收到一次 push 之后,Git Hook 就能帮你执行一次 bash 脚本。...这个hook在git服务受到push请求,并且接受完代码提交时触发。 具体代码体现,在git远端仓库的hooks目录下新建post-receive文件: 三代码 #!...nginx服务的 git用户属于git组 nginx属于nginx组 所以在这里就是把post-receive设置成nginx组 如果不设置的话在站点目录下是没有办法更新文件的(会提示没有权限操作

    2.9K10

    在ASP.NET MVC5中实现具有服务过滤、排序和分页的GridView

    介绍 在本文中,我们将会学习如何实现服务端的分页,搜索和排序功能。从长远来讲,这是一种更好的方式来应对数据集特别大的情况。 我们将会修改前文中的源代码,现在就开始吧!...进入 Index.cshtml 文件并通过移除表单的 thead 和 tbody 元素来更新 HTML,更新 HTML 如下所示: <div class="col-md...,然后检查所有列中<em>是否</em>符合标准的数据都返回了。...现在 build 这个工程并在浏览中运行,就可以查看带有服务<em>器</em>端<em>过滤</em>、<em>分页</em>和排序的 GridView 了。...在服务<em>器</em>端实现表格的<em>过滤</em>、<em>分页</em>和排序等功能,能够减少客户端数据处理的任务量,方便更好更快的加载并显示数据。

    5.4K80

    Web 后端的一生之敌:分页

    他继续浏览,发现第二页的第一篇文章仍然是 《Redis 缓存更新一致性》: 博客园使用的是时间倒序排列和limit..offset分页,用 SQL 来描述就是: select * from posts...后置过滤会遇到一种问题,客户端向我们请求 10 篇文章而服务端过滤只剩下了 8 篇甚至某一页可能一篇不剩。...聪明的读者可能会想这个问题好解决,如果请求 10 篇文章过滤只剩下 8 篇,那我们再从数据库中取出 10 篇只要过滤剩下 2 篇以上是不是就可以满足客户端的请求了?...另一个问题是分页接口通常需要告知客户端结果总数或者总页数以便客户端判断是否到达最后一页,而使用了后置过滤的查询几乎不可能查出结果总数,emmm 深度分页带来的性能消耗 MySQL 深度分页的性能问题以及使用自增主键优化深度分页已经广为人知...游标分页中不再有具体的页码概念也不再需要总页数,只需要知道当前是否为最后一页即可。我们可以在查询数据库时可以将 limit 加 1 来方便地判断当前是否是最后一页。

    15610

    瑞吉外卖-员工管理

    这种设计并不合理,我们希望看到的效果应该是,只有登录成功才可以访问系统中的页面,如果没有登录则跳转到登录页面。 那么,具体应该怎么实现呢?...答案就是使用过滤器或者拦截,在过滤器或者拦截中判断用户是否已经完成登录,如果没有登录则跳转到登录页面。...# 代码开发 实现步骤: 创建自定义过滤器LoginCheckFilter 在启动类上加入注解@ServletComponentScan 完善过滤器的处理逻辑 过滤器具体的处理逻辑如下: 获取本次请求的...需要注意,只有管理员(admin用户)可以对其他普通用户进行启用、禁用操作,所以普通用户登录系统启用、禁用按钮不显示。...分页查询时服务端响应给页面的数据中id的值为19位数字,类型为long 页面中js处理long型数字只能精确到前16位,所以最终通过ajax请求提交给服务的时候id变为了1520694192883232800

    1K40

    RESTful API 设计最佳实践

    所以我这篇文章的目标是从实践的角度出发,给出当前网络应用的API设计最佳实践(当然,是我认为的最佳了~),如果觉得不合适,我不会遵从标准。...如果有更新(特别是公开的API),应该及时更新文档。文档中应该有关于何时弃用某个API的时间表以及详情。使用邮件列表或者博客记录是好方法。...结果过滤,排序,搜索: url最好越简短越好,和结果过滤,排序,搜索相关的功能都应该通过参数实现(并且也很容易实现)。 过滤:为所有提供过滤功能的接口提供统一的参数。...url作为返回头 是否需要 “HATEOAS“ 网上关于是否允许用户创建新的url有很大的异议(注意不是创建资源产生的url)。...分页 分页数据可以放到“信封”里面,但随着标准的改进,现在我推荐将分页信息放到link header里面:http://tools.ietf.org/html/rfc5988#page-6。

    1.5K40

    PowerBI 2020.11 月更新 - 各类图标更新及查找异常

    这是十一月Power BI更新的完整列表: 报告方面 新字段列表(预览) 新模型视图(预览) 应用所有过滤器现已普遍可用 可视缩放滑块 数据点矩形选择扩展到“地图视觉” Web连接的证书吊销检查 分页报表更新...如果要推迟何时应用过滤器更改,那么该功能很有用,这样,在准备将任何过滤器更改应用于报表或视觉效果,只需等待一次即可。 请注意,您可以在报告级别设置此功能。但是,该功能默认情况下处于关闭状态。...分页报表更新 分页报告样本报告 我们很高兴为您介绍官方的分页报告样本,供您下载并在Power BI服务中试用。要了解更多信息,请查看有关如何从GitHub下载示例报告的文档。...是否有Power App使用 Common Data Service, 并想使用分页报告从中打印发票?您现在也可以这样做! 在此博客文章中阅读更多内容。...例如,要更新数据源的详细信息,您必须是数据源的所有者。分页报表的Take API可以帮助您获得源的所有权,以便您对其进行更新

    8.3K30

    RESTful API 设计最佳实践

    所以我这篇文章的目标是从实践的角度出发,给出当前网络应用的API设计最佳实践(当然,是我认为的最佳了~),如果觉得不合适,我不会遵从标准。...结果过滤,排序,搜索: url最好越简短越好,和结果过滤,排序,搜索相关的功能都应该通过参数实现(并且也很容易实现)。 过滤:为所有提供过滤功能的接口提供统一的参数。...url作为返回头 是否需要 “HATEOAS“ 网上关于是否允许用户创建新的url有很大的异议(注意不是创建资源产生的url)。...分页 分页数据可以放到“信封”里面,但随着标准的改进,现在我推荐将分页信息放到link header里面:http://tools.ietf.org/html/rfc5988#page-6。...注意使用url参数的问题是:目前大部分的网络服务都会讲query参数保存到服务日志中,这可能会成为大的安全风险。

    1.6K90

    关于 Element 组件的穿梭框的重构

    然后判断已选区域中是否有该省级一下的市级,有则删除,合并成一个省级,并在省级过滤数组删除掉这个市级 id 市级点击添加选中的城市,选中的城市对象数组,遍历拼接上当前的 father 对象,最终保存的形式...:{id: "10005-545132025515", text: "广东省-广州市"},也要判断当前市级下是否有对应的区级,有则合并,并在区级过滤数组删除这个区级 id 区级点击添加选中的区域,拼接上当前的...最终的保存的形式:{id:"10004-15613610-25156165156321", text:"广东省-河源市-龙川县"} 子组件 transfer 中区域数据 districtList 需要放在监听里...,当点击省级或市级,自动监听更新市级或区级的列表 从已选中删除 选中已选区域的数据,传递到父组件,同样的道理,删除过滤数组对应的 id,并刷新对应的区域数据 监听仓库与区域对应 找出选中仓库的对应省级...搜索的结果也会自动分页

    7.6K40

    优化网页加载,缓存分页技巧

    减轻服务压力: 缓存分页可以减少服务每次请求都需要进行数据库查询和数据处理的次数,从而降低服务的负载,提高系统整体性能和稳定性。...缓存分页的工作原理数据查询与缓存: 当用户请求某一页数据时,服务首先会执行数据库查询以获取所需数据。然后,将查询结果按照指定的分页大小进行切割,并将切割的数据缓存起来。...缓存命中: 如果用户在之后的请求中继续访问相同的页面,服务会先检查缓存中是否已经存在该页数据的缓存。如果存在,则直接从缓存中读取数据,跳过数据库查询和数据处理步骤,从而提高响应速度。...使用文件缓存实现分页步骤:当用户请求某一页数据时,先检查服务文件系统中是否已经存在该页数据的缓存文件,如果存在,则直接读取文件内容返回给用户;如果不存在,则进行数据库查询,并将查询结果保存为缓存文件。...缓存穿透和击穿: 针对缓存穿透和缓存击穿等问题,可以采用布隆过滤器、热点数据预热等技术进行预防和处理。

    17300

    瑞吉外卖实战项目全攻略——第二天

    我们在之前的login功能中如果登陆成功就会给Session加入一个employee的ID值,我们凭借ID来判断是否登录 此外,我们需要在进入页面之前进行判断,那么我们就需要构造一个过滤器或者拦截,...查看数据库是否发生改变即可(因为主页面的分页操作还未完成,我们无法在前台看到信息) 异常处理 在介绍下一节之前,我们需要注意: 数据库中的ID设为主键,意味着我们的账号只能设置单独的ID 因此,如果我们连续两次输入...我们的功能完善一般分为三步 需求分析 我们要将数据库信息通过分页查询的方法查询出来并反馈到页面中 我们打开页面,直接查找报错的部分,查看其请求信息以及相关URL: 打开负载,查看传递的信息:...还需要注意的是,当我们输入查询信息,我们会多一个参数name,这个参数也需要进行后台操作: 我们需要注意的是我们采用的是数据库的分页查询,因此我们需要设置一个分页插件来将数据插入 此外我们的代码书写只需要采用...跳转页面时带有数据即可 易错点 在这里我们会点出该项目目前容易出错的位置 过滤器的使用 Filter也称之为过滤器,它是Servlet技术中的技术,Web开发人员通过Filter技术,对web服务管理的所有

    47720

    周末小技 | 开发一个Feeds流系统——写扩散模式

    二、为什么会有Feeds流 了解了什么是Feeds流,我们可以从产品角度思考一下,为什么会有Feeds流。 我们可以和传统的信息获取渠道,电视,报纸,杂志进行对比。...这样,用户可以通过订阅获取即时信息,而不用每天都检查各个订阅源是否更新。 可以看出,上述方式很像是在订购杂志,杂志一旦更新,就会寄到家中。但是那时候的的Rss系统,能订阅的只是新闻网站以及博客。...Feeds流是一个动态列表,每时每刻都可能在更新,所以传统的使用page_size和page_num来分页就不能满足使用了。因为但凡两页之间出现内容的添加或删除,都会导致错位问题。...如此一来,用户在自己的读取收件箱中消息的时候,是先获取了消息Id,再去数据库查出消息内容,而后判断状态进行过滤,把已经删除的状态剔除,不返回给前端。此时也需要重新进行捞数据,填充分页内容。...(写扩散) 取消关注他人时,用户的收件箱如何刷新:这里可以采用过滤的方式:我们从收件箱中获取到了消息id,而后需要进行回查,但是回查前,判断该id的所属发送人是否还在自己关注列表中。

    1.3K20

    Restful 接口设计最佳事件

    所以我这篇文章的目标是从实践的角度出发,给出当前网络应用的API设计最佳实践(当然,是我认为的最佳了~),如果觉得不合适,我不会遵从标准。...如果有更新(特别是公开的API),应该及时更新文档。文档中应该有关于何时弃用某个API的时间表以及详情。使用邮件列表或者博客记录是好方法。...结果过滤,排序,搜索: url最好越简短越好,和结果过滤,排序,搜索相关的功能都应该通过参数实现(并且也很容易实现)。 过滤:为所有提供过滤功能的接口提供统一的参数。...url作为返回头 是否需要 “HATEOAS“ 网上关于是否允许用户创建新的url有很大的异议(注意不是创建资源产生的url)。...分页 分页数据可以放到“信封”里面,但随着标准的改进,现在我推荐将分页信息放到link header里面:http://tools.ietf.org/html/rfc5988#page-6。

    88530

    基于游标的分页接口实现

    但是这是一种比较常规的数据分页处理方式,适用于没有什么动态的过滤条件的数据。...如果是数据源来自Redis,我的建议是在全局缓存一份完整的列表,定时更新数据,然后在接口层面通过slice来获取本次请求所需的部分数据。 P.S....抑或是我们需要判断当前某条数据的状态,例如主播是否已经关闭了直播间,推流状态是否正常,这些可能会调用其他的接口来进行验证。...上述两个关键功能的函数实现,就需要有一个用来检查、拼接数据的函数出现了。...(当然了,如果列表没有什么过滤条件,就是一个普通的展示,那么建议使用第一种,没有必要添加这些逻辑处理了) 小结 当然了,这只是从服务端能够做到的一些分页相关的处理,但是这依然没有解决所有的问题,类似一些更新速度较快的列表

    1.7K20

    180多个Web应用程序测试示例测试用例

    10.当结果多于每页默认结果数时,应启用分页。 11.检查下一页,上一页,第一页和最后一页的分页功能。 12.重复的记录不应显示在结果网格中。 13.检查所有列是否可见,并在必要时启用水平滚动条。...16.对于显示报告的结果网格,启用分页功能,请选中“总计”行数据,并导航到下一页。 17.检查是否使用正确的符号显示列值,例如,应显示%符号以进行百分比计算。...3.检查页面上是否有任何具有默认焦点的字段(通常,焦点应设置在屏幕的第一个输入字段上)。 4.在关闭父窗口/打开窗口时,检查子窗口是否已关闭。...14.检查表审计列的值(例如创建日期,创建者,创建者,更新者,更新者,删除者,删除数据者,删除者等)是否已填充正确地。 15.在保存时检查输入数据是否未被截断。...11.检查“文件选择”对话框是否仅显示列出的受支持文件。 12.检查多个图像上传功能。 13.上传检查图像质量。上传不得更改图像质量。 14.检查用户是否能够使用/查看上载的图像。

    8.3K21

    WebGenerate 产品介绍

    在线模式:适用于已建立了数据库,并且数据库更新比较频繁的项目。 离线模式:用户仅需要提交DDL的SQL文件,即可生产工程。...WebGenerate生产代码的过程非常简单: 1)用户通过WebGenerate后台管理系统创建项目,并填写数据库信息(或提交SQL文件); 2)完成上面的步骤,即可生成工程文件,包括生成完整包、生成框架包...2)业务系统,我们从以下三个角度去了解业务系统: 框架角度:WebGenerate会自动生产基础框架代码、以及和数据表匹配的jsp、js、css、controller、service、DAO、model...、viewer等代码,其次,实现了对session、servlet生命周期的监听、管理,实现了按角色、功能、权限等多维度的权限管理策略,实现了白名单对请求的过滤、控制;实现了事务、日志等基础框架功能的配套实施...:对应的外键表需要显示的字段,用于在controller中的prop函数进行属性拓展使用; 列表显示:是否在列表显示; 表单显示:是否在表单显示; 表单必填:用于生产的页面元素是否为必填项; 提示显示:

    1.3K70

    Mybatis Plus 3.4版本之后分页插件的使用

    MybatisPlusInterceptor是一系列的实现InnerInterceptor的拦截链,也可以理解为一个集合。...可以包括如下的一些拦截 自动分页: PaginationInnerInterceptor(最常用) 多租户: TenantLineInnerInterceptor 动态表名: DynamicTableNameInnerInterceptor...乐观锁: OptimisticLockerInnerInterceptor sql性能规范: IllegalSQLInnerInterceptor 防止全表更新与删除: BlockAttackInnerInterceptor...,一缓和二缓遵循mybatis的规则,需要设置 MybatisConfiguration#useDeprecatedExecutor = false 避免缓存出现问题(该属性会在旧插件移除一同移除)...mybatisPlusInterceptor() { MybatisPlusInterceptor interceptor = new MybatisPlusInterceptor(); //向Mybatis过滤器链中添加分页拦截

    5.5K20
    领券